Merge pull request #6035 from gojimmypi/PK_SSL_init_vars

Initialize `OPENSSL_ALL` local size / length / type vars
This commit is contained in:
David Garske 2023-01-31 09:09:18 -08:00 committed by GitHub
commit 9defb9a356
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 9 additions and 9 deletions

View File

@ -3402,9 +3402,9 @@ int wolfSSL_RSA_padding_add_PKCS1_PSS(WOLFSSL_RSA *rsa, unsigned char *em,
{
int ret = 1;
enum wc_HashType hashType;
int hashLen;
int emLen;
int mgf;
int hashLen = 0;
int emLen = 0;
int mgf = 0;
int initTmpRng = 0;
WC_RNG *rng = NULL;
#ifdef WOLFSSL_SMALL_STACK
@ -3534,11 +3534,11 @@ int wolfSSL_RSA_verify_PKCS1_PSS(WOLFSSL_RSA *rsa, const unsigned char *mHash,
const unsigned char *em, int saltLen)
{
int ret = 1;
int hashLen;
int mgf;
int emLen;
int mPrimeLen;
enum wc_HashType hashType;
int hashLen = 0;
int mgf = 0;
int emLen = 0;
int mPrimeLen = 0;
enum wc_HashType hashType = WC_HASH_TYPE_NONE;
byte *mPrime = NULL;
byte *buf = NULL;

View File

@ -38218,7 +38218,7 @@ int wolfSSL_PEM_write_bio_PKCS8PrivateKey(WOLFSSL_BIO* bio,
byte* key = NULL;
word32 keySz;
byte* pem = NULL;
int pemSz;
int pemSz = 0;
int type = PKCS8_PRIVATEKEY_TYPE;
int algId;
const byte* curveOid;